To reduce the spread of germs, all families need to have their own instruments – a set for you and a set for each of your children. Here is the list of instruments you will need to bring over the course of our 6-week session. I’ll let you know each week which instruments to bring:

– *Shaker Eggs – one for each hand
– *Small Tambourine
– *Wrist bell
– Rhythm Sticks – one for each hand, can use wooden spoons
– Scarf – sheer, if possible
– Variety of small instruments for jam session – DIY is fine; 2 or 3 to choose from
– Small pillow for lullaby

 

For your convenience, I have organized to provide music kits for those who need them, which will include the items above marked with a *. Each person will receive 2 Shaker Eggs, 1 Tambourine, 1 Wrist Bell. These instruments are professional quality and come from a trusted vendor. As with all instruments, however, you will still need to supervise your children while they are playing with them, in class and at home. The cost of the kit is $20 per person. I recommend that all students have identical instruments to avoid “toy envy,” allowing for more focus on learning, and the kits provide that consistency.

For those of you who already have the necessary instruments at home, you are, of course, welcome to use them and can order additional kits, as needed. As for the rhythm sticks, scarves and jam session instruments, I figured everyone can rummage around their homes and come up with something compatible, perhaps from a Dollar Store or other inexpensive source. We will also use the resonator bells and drums from my collection, which I will disinfect before and after each class.
